What is Long March 10B First-Stage Sea Recovery?

This refers to the recovery of the first stage of the Long March 10B launch vehicle after it lands on a floating platform positioned in the ocean downrange from the launch site, rather than being discarded into the sea and lost. Guided descent and a controlled engine burn slow the stage for a vertical landing on the platform, after which it is towed back to port to be refurbished and reused for a future launch.
